AnswerThere are many different games called football today, among which are American football, Soccer, Rugby, all of which have rules that are pretty well codified. Games that are played informally today generally are based on these written codes of rules, to some degree or other. By contrast, medieval football had very few rules. In fact the rules were so sparse that what was called "mob football" had no limits on the numbers of players each side could have.Please use the link below for more information on medieval football.

Ivy League schools had been playing various types of kicking games as far back as the 1820s. The first recognized intercollegiate football game happened in 1869 between Rutgers and Princeton, although that game probably resembled soccer more than the game we know today.

The winner of the most Army vs. Navy football games since 1970 is the Navy. They are 26-14-1 against the Army since then, with the tie being in 1981. The Navy has won the last 12 straight games against Army.
